Table 10. DC Volts Test
789 Range Calibrator DC Voltage Minimum Reading Maximum Reading
4 V dc 1 V 0.998 V 1.002 V
4 V dc 3 V 2.996 V 3.004 V
40 V dc 10 V 9.98 V 10.02 V
40 V dc 30 V 29.96 V 30.04 V
400 V dc 100 V 99.8 V 100.2 V
400 V dc 300 V 299.6 V 300.4 V
1000 V dc 100 V 99 101
1000 V dc 800 V 798 802
AC Volts Measurement Test
 Warning
To prevent possible electrical shock, fire, or personal injury:
Some of the calibration verification tests involve the use of high
voltages and should be performed by qualified personnel only.
Always place the calibrator in the Standby (STBY) mode between
tests and before handling the test connections or test cables.
1. Put the calibrator in Standby (STBY) mode.
2. Put the UUT rotary switch in the S position.
3. Connect the calibrator to the
COM and terminals on the UUT as shown in
Figure 9.
4. Apply the values from the calibrator shown in Table 11 and compare the readings on
the UUT to the acceptable readings shown.
Table 11. AC Volts Test
789 Range Calibrator Voltage and Frequency
Minimum Acceptable
Reading
Maximum Acceptable
Reading
400 mV ac 100 mV @ 60 Hz 98.9 mV 101.1 mV
400 mV ac 300 mV @ 60 Hz 297.5 mV 302.5 mV
4 V ac 1 V @ 60 Hz 0.991 V 1.009 V
4 V ac 2 V @ 60 Hz 1.984 V 2.016 V
4 V ac 3 V @ 60 Hz 2.977 V 3.023 V
40 V ac 10 V @ 60 Hz 9.91 V 10.09 V
40 V ac 30 V @ 60 Hz 29.77 V 30.23 V
400 V ac 100 V @ 60 Hz 99.1 V 100.9 V
400 V ac 300 V @ 60 Hz 297.7 V 302.3 V
1000 V ac 100 V @ 60 Hz 97 103
1000 V ac 800 V @ 60 Hz 792 808
